{"id":613895,"date":"2026-04-19T06:12:24","date_gmt":"2026-04-19T06:12:24","guid":{"rendered":"https:\/\/www.newsbeep.com\/ca\/613895\/"},"modified":"2026-04-19T06:12:24","modified_gmt":"2026-04-19T06:12:24","slug":"wide-world-of-pets-on-display-this-weekend-at-reptile-expo-and-calgary-cat-show","status":"publish","type":"post","link":"https:\/\/www.newsbeep.com\/ca\/613895\/","title":{"rendered":"Wide world of pets on display this weekend at Reptile Expo and Calgary Cat Show"},"content":{"rendered":"<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">Pet enthusiasts of all kinds can find something to do in Calgary this weekend, with both the Reptile Expo and Calgary Cat Show taking place Saturday and Sunday.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">The Western Canadian Reptile Expo returned this year at the\u00a0Acadia Recreation Centre, running April 18-19 and offering interactive experiences with exotic animals, as well as knowledgeable breeders and vendors.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">Greg West, one of the event\u2019s promoters, said the expo is great for reptile enthusiasts and hobbyists, but also for curious newcomers, and is expected to draw crowds of up to 10,000 people.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">\u201cThese are great experiences for anybody who\u2019s never seen, never interacted with reptiles,\u201d he said. \u201cWe\u2019ve got an interactive aspect of the show. It\u2019s very educational.\u201d<\/p>\n<p><img alt=\" Visitors meet a boa at the Western Canadian Reptile Expo at the Acadia Recreation Centre on Saturday.\" loading=\"lazy\" width=\"960\" height=\"720\" decoding=\"async\" data-nimg=\"1\" class=\"rounded-lg\" style=\"color:transparent\" src=\"https:\/\/www.newsbeep.com\/ca\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/04\/1034d1126522f3a81b47e35f5c63083a.jpeg\"\/><\/p>\n<p> Visitors meet a boa at the Western Canadian Reptile Expo at the Acadia Recreation Centre on Saturday.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">Many of the booths are trusted breeders and other vendors, as well as exotic animal rescues and sanctuaries, all of whom have expertise they\u2019re happy to share with attendees.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">\u201cIt\u2019s nice to be able to educate people about proper care, how these animals are a little more misunderstood and can make amazing pets,\u201d West said. \u201cA big part of growing our hobby is dispelling all those myths.\u201d<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">For him, some of the event\u2019s highlights are the exotic animals that attendees can interact with, including sloths, kangaroos, porcupines and a Burmese python.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">\u201cWe\u2019ve got restricted species here with people who have proper permits, so you can see some of the things that you might not see, other than maybe in zoos,\u201d he said.<\/p>\n<p><img alt=\" Visitors get up close with a baby kangaroo from Cobb\u2019s Exotic Animal Rescue during the Western Canadian Reptile Expo at the Acadia Recreation Centre on Saturday.\" loading=\"lazy\" width=\"960\" height=\"720\" decoding=\"async\" data-nimg=\"1\" class=\"rounded-lg\" style=\"color:transparent\" src=\"https:\/\/www.newsbeep.com\/ca\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/04\/84dcdc9e28c8633071a765be37595c2b.jpeg\"\/><\/p>\n<p> Visitors get up close with a baby kangaroo from Cobb\u2019s Exotic Animal Rescue during the Western Canadian Reptile Expo at the Acadia Recreation Centre on Saturday.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">McKenzi Watson, co-owner of Manitoba-based sanctuary Prairie Exotics, was stationed at a booth featuring a variety of reptiles that had been surrendered, including an 18-year-old Burmese python named Popcorn.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">Many of the animals ended up in Prairie Exotics\u2019 care either because someone moved somewhere with different restrictions for exotic pets, or because the owners didn\u2019t fully understand what they were getting into.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">\u201cI\u2019d say 98 per cent of what we do is education,\u201d Watson said, adding that, when looking into an exotic pet, it\u2019s important to understand things like the animal\u2019s expected size and lifespan, behaviour and care needs before making the commitment.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">\u201cThey\u2019re not just toys,\u201d she said,\u00a0\u201cYour average person shouldn\u2019t own an alligator or even a Burmese python. Sometimes a bearded dragon is even a good fit for some people, versus maybe something like a corn snake or ball python.\u201d<\/p>\n<p><img alt=\" Cobb\u2019s Exotic Animal Rescue\u2019s Ashley Orsted Orsted introduces the Hiscock family to a two-toed sloth during the Western Canadian Reptile Expo.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">Nicole Hiscock and sons Nathan and Marcus were visiting the expo for the first time Saturday, guided by Hiscock\u2019s brother, a former reptile breeder and vendor at expos in Toronto.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">\u201cI\u2019m just looking forward to seeing what they have here, and seeing all the different types of reptiles and insects,\u201d Hiscock said.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">Her brother, Mitchell Whyte, said his goal was to expose the boys to the world of reptiles, and dispel some of the misconceptions.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">\u201cThere\u2019s a huge stigma in the pet industry toward what snakes and what reptiles are prone to doing,\u201d he said. \u201cIt\u2019s nice to expose the kids to it, to know, \u2018Here\u2019s what they\u2019re really like.&#8217;\u201d<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">For those who prefer furrier friends, the Calgary Cat Show is taking place Saturday and Sunday at the Southland Leisure Centre, with more than 100 participating cats and kittens and nine International Cat Association judges from around the world.<\/p>\n<p><img alt=\" Sharon classification during the Calgary Cat Show at the Southland Leisure Centre on Saturday.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">Vancouver resident Sharon Wong travelled to Calgary to show her seven-month-old Bengal cat, Nico, who won top prize in the kitten category on Saturday afternoon.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">\u201cWe competed in Vancouver Island last week,\u201d Wong said, noting this weekend was Nico\u2019s second ever show, though Wong has had other show cats in the past.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">Bengals aren\u2019t difficult to keep well groomed, she said, so most of the work is in their training.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">\u201cBengals need attention,\u201d she said. \u201cWe need to handle them every day to make sure they\u2019re good to show and very nice to handle.\u201d<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">Most breeds have very specific breed standards, said Robert Seliskar, one of the show\u2019s judges, but there\u2019s also a category for household pets, which are judged on how well groomed they are and their temperament.<\/p>\n<p><img alt=\" Rob Seliskar judges during the Calgary Cat Show at the Southland Leisure Centre on Saturday.\" loading=\"lazy\" width=\"960\" height=\"720\" decoding=\"async\"
